Statistical Link Between Early Retirement and Longevity
Initial large-scale studies attempting to link the timing of retirement to survival have yielded mixed results. Analyses of data from certain employee cohorts, such as a study of Shell Oil workers, found that employees who retired at age 55 had a higher mortality risk compared to those who worked until age 65. For those retiring a full decade early, the death rate was found to be as much as 37% higher. Other studies, including analyses of U.S. Social Security data, have similarly suggested that men claiming benefits at the earliest age of 62 face a higher mortality risk than those who wait until the standard retirement age. However, this statistical link often disappears when researchers account for prior health and demographics. This suggests the observed correlation is frequently due to selection bias, where individuals with pre-existing health issues are forced to retire earlier. The data points less to the act of retiring itself and more to the circumstances surrounding the decision.
Impact on Physical Health and Stress Hormones
The most direct benefit anticipated from leaving the workforce is a reduction in chronic occupational stress, which positively influences biological markers. Work-related strain often leads to a sustained elevation of the stress hormone cortisol, contributing to a blunted diurnal slope. Retirement is associated with a shift toward a steeper cortisol slope, indicating a more advantageous biological stress profile. Chronically high cortisol levels are associated with increased inflammation, higher blood pressure, and elevated blood sugar, all risk factors for cardiovascular disease.
The removal of the rigid work schedule also allows for improvements in sleep hygiene and duration. Studies show that retirees gain an average of 20 to 30 minutes of sleep per night and experience fewer sleep disturbances because they are no longer bound by an alarm clock. This increased flexibility reduces the biological debt that builds up from years of insufficient sleep.
Retirees also gain the opportunity for more physical activity, though the outcome depends heavily on the former occupation. Individuals who retired from sedentary or desk-based jobs are the most likely to show an increase in leisure-time physical activity. Conversely, those who leave physically demanding manual labor jobs may see a decline in their total daily activity, which can lead to mobility issues and illness conditions.
Maintaining Cognitive Engagement and Social Structure
The abrupt cessation of a career removes the daily intellectual and social structure that the workplace provides, posing a risk to cognitive health. The loss of routine and stimulating demands can contribute to the disengagement of complex neural pathways. Social isolation is linked to a 26% increased risk of developing dementia and is associated with shrinkage in parts of the brain critical for cognition.
To counter this, maintaining high levels of cognitive and social engagement is a protective factor. Activities that require problem-solving, learning new skills, or teaching others help sustain neuroplasticity, the brain’s ability to form new connections.
Volunteering is consistently linked to better cognitive function, including stronger executive function and episodic memory. These meaningful social roles provide a blend of intellectual stimulation, a sense of purpose, and physical activity that mitigates the mental health risks of retirement. The most successful mental outcomes are seen in those who replace the demands of work with new activities that are both enjoyable and sufficiently challenging.
The Influence of Financial Health and Pre-Retirement Status
The factors influencing longevity after retirement are health and wealth status established long before leaving the workforce. Longevity differences across socioeconomic status (SES) are stark; older adults in the lowest wealth brackets die, on average, nine years earlier than their most affluent peers. Individuals who are financially secure often already possess superior health, better healthcare access, and lower baseline stress levels when they retire.
The distinction between voluntary and involuntary retirement is important in interpreting the longevity data. Poor health is the primary driver for early, unplanned retirement for more than half of middle-aged workers. This type of forced exit is associated with negative health consequences, including increased depression and anxiety.
Financial hardship is a powerful stressor. Experiencing a large financial loss can increase the risk of mortality by as much as 50%. This financial stress, compounded by a lack of choice in the retirement timing, often explains why some early retirees experience a decline in health, rather than the act of retiring itself.
